Zhytomyr paratroopers destroy two enemy BMP-2 IFVs

video

Ukrainian defenders have destroyed two enemy infantry fighting vehicles using a Stugna-P anti-tank missile system.

The press service of the Ukrainian Air Assault Forces said this on Telegram, Ukrinform reports.

"The video shows anti-tank soldiers of the 95th Air Assault Brigade of the Ukrainian Air Assault Forces skillfully using a domestic Stugna-P anti-tank missile system and enchantingly burning two enemy BMP-2 infantry fighting vehicles," the statement said.
